5 Typical Root Causes Of Water Damage in Washrooms


These are the usual factors you would certainly have water damage in your bathrooms and how you can spot them:

Burst or Leaking Pipes


There are numerous pipes carrying water to different parts of your restroom. Some pipes take water to the toilet, the sink, the taps, the shower, as well as numerous other places. They crisscross the tiny location of the washroom.
Once in a while, these pipes can obtain rusty and burst. Other times, human activity can create them to leakage. When this takes place, you'll discover water in the edges of your shower room or on the wall surface.
To identify this, watch out for bubbling walls, molds, or mold. Call a specialist emergency situation plumber to repair this when it takes place.

Fractures in your wall tilesv
Bathroom wall surface floor tiles have actually been particularly created for that function. They shield the wall surface from dampness from individuals taking showers. Nevertheless, they are not unbreakable.
In some cases, your bathroom wall surface ceramic tiles crack and allow some dampness to permeate right into the wall. This can possibly ruin the wall surface if you don't take any kind of action. If you notice a split on your wall surface tiles, repair it promptly. Do not wait up until it destroys your wall.
Overruning bathrooms and also sinks
As humans, sometimes we make mistakes that can trigger some water damage in the washroom. For example, leaving your sink tap on might create overflowing and damages to other parts of the bathroom with wetness.
Likewise, a faulty toilet might create overflowing. As an example, a damaged commode manage or various other parts of the cistern. When this takes place, it can harm the flooring.
As soon as you see an overflowing sink or commode, call a plumbing technician to aid handle it immediately.

Roofing Leakages


In some cases, the trouble of water damage to the bathroom could not come from the shower room. For instance, a roof covering leak can cause damages to the shower room ceiling. You can spot the damage done by considering the water discolorations on the ceiling.
If you locate water spots on your ceiling, examine the roof to see if it's damaged. After that, call a specialist to help resolve the problem.

Excess Dampness


It's awesome to have that long shower as well as dash water while you hem and haw and act like you're carrying out, yet in some cases these acts might create water damage to your restroom.
Sprinkling water around can create water to head to corners as well as develop mold and mildews. Watch just how you spread out excess dampness around, and also when you do it, clean it up to stop damages.

Common Causes of Water Damage in a Bathroom


Water damage can appear virtually anywhere in your home, but bathrooms and basements are the two most common areas. It’s easier to spot causes and signs of water damage in an unfinished basement, but that doesn’t mean it’s any less severe to have water damage occur in your bathroom.


Spotting Signs of Bathroom Water Damage


The bathroom is probably the most common place where you’ll use water in your home. Because of this, there’s a relatively high risk of sustaining water damage. The longer water damage goes untreated, the worse it can get. Therefore, you need to know what signs to look for and deal with any damage as soon as possible.


There are often items like rugs, bottles, towels, and so on crammed in every corner of the typical bathroom, which can trap moisture and hide budding problems. But what usually causes the most water damage in a bathroom? How can you spot it, especially with so many items in the way? This article addresses several common ways to notice, prevent, or fix bathroom water damage.


A Recurring or Persistent Musty Odor


Wherever there’s water damage, you almost always find small spots of mold, or even a full-blown infestation. When you leave mold to thrive and grow, it creates a stinking, musty odor that’s pretty hard to miss. Don’t leave musty smells unaddressed—try to find the source so that you can have it repaired before more damage occurs.


Damaged Grout or Caulk


When these sealing agents fail, virtually nothing prevents water from seeping past the barrier, causing water damage and mold growth underneath wall and flooring tiles. Damaged showerheads, spigots, grout, or caulking, combined with excessive moisture, create the perfect environment for mold to thrive.


Loose Tiles or Spongy Floors


Moldy and water-damaged walls make it more difficult for tiles to stay in place, which can cause them to become loose. In addition, persistent moisture on a bathroom floor can result in water damage to the subflooring layer, causing it to degrade, lose integrity, and feel spongy.


Stubborn Growth


If there’s visible mold in your bathroom that you’ve removed more than once, the most likely reason it keeps coming back is a deeper infestation in the walls or floors. It’s critical to deal with this problem immediately to prevent further damage and new or worsening health issues.
